/**
  *	Calculates supplier product price based on product id and expression id
  *
  *	@param	int					$product_id    	The Product id to get information
  *	@param	int 				$expression_id  The expression to parse
  *	@param	int					$quantity     	Min quantity
  *	@param	int					$tva_tx     	VAT rate
  *	@param	array 				$extra_values   Any aditional values for expression
  *  @return int 				> 0 if OK, < 1 if KO
  */
 public function parseProductSupplier($product_id, $expression_id, $quantity = null, $tva_tx = null, $extra_values = array())
 {
     //Get the expression from db
     $price_expression = new PriceExpression($this->db);
     $res = $price_expression->fetch($expression_id);
     if ($res < 1) {
         $this->error = array(19, null);
         return -1;
     }
     //Parse the expression and return the price
     return $this->parseProductSupplierExpression($product_id, $price_expression->expression, $quantity, $tva_tx, $extra_values);
 }
